Programme Overview

The SME-to-Educator Transition Track is a workforce transformation programme that enables organisations to convert critical expert knowledge into scalable workforce capability. By equipping technical specialists to systematically transfer and embed their expertise, organisations can strengthen knowledge continuity, accelerate workforce readiness, and improve operational performance.

Strategic Outcomes
  • Analyse and deconstruct highly complex proprietary technical process into an objective, logical step-by-step written task analysis

  • Create a functional, high-utility OJT checklist or visual troubleshooting job aid for a specific operational machine or system

  • Develop digital micro-learning resources that preserve critical tacit knowledge and enable scalable expertise transfer across teams and locations

  • Deliver an effective 4-step physical or digital technical demonstration (Briefing, Demonstration, Monitored Application, Facilitated Reflection) tailored exactly to the baseline profile of a junior staff or apprentice

  • Evaluate learner performance and deliver evidence-based developmental feedback that improves operational execution, safety and quality outcomes

  • Evaluate a peer's operational performance accurately using a criteria-referenced competency matrix, reducing assessment subjectivity

Programme Outline

Module 1: The Identity Shift 

Navigating the identity transition and overcoming the structural "curse of knowledge" when moving from expert executor to workplace educator.


Module 2: Knowledge Engineering

Deconstructing intuitive expert execution into transparent, logical technical workflows, isolating "must-know" rules from background theory.


Module 3: Workplace Learning Design

Building standardized OJT blueprints, visual tool guides, quick reference trouble matrices, and clear operational checklists.

Module 4: High-Acuity Field Coaching

Module 5: Competency Validation    

Craft objective, criteria-based rubrics to check safety, environmental compliance and independent task readiness.


Module 6: Craft Reusable Learning Artefacts

Storyboard and record workplace procedures for specialisedoperational contexts, converting paper manuals into mobile-accessible digital job aids.


Module 7: Mentorship Networks

Organise long-term, cross-generational mentoring partnerships to help secure institutional memory.


Module 8: Capstone Project

Apply project planning and implementation skills to deploy a co-created technical package within their department and present the resulting outcomes to a supervisor review panel.

Target Audience

Who Should Attend this SME-to-Educator Transition Programme? 

Designed for experienced practitioners who need to teach, coach, assess and transfer critical knowledge effectively.
